Geneva Vlog: Josh Hill

What happened when Josh Hill, aboard an electric bike, went up against Ricky Carmichael in a head-to-head race in Switzerland? Well, this video that Hill released sums it all up. Just look at the speed that the Alta bike has out of the gate! It is really impressive, right?

Video: Josh Hill | Lead Image: Monster Energy Media/Hiishii

MX Vice Editor || 25